The systems widely apply frequency agility technology to avoid reconnaissance and interference, this technology have very broad working frequency. Because of the broad 3dB bandwidth of the magnetic tunable bandpass filter modules, they are designed in instantaneous bandwidth receivers, to quickly capture the frequency agility signal. It is difficult to cover the working frequency of 2-18GHz by using a single broadband filter. The traditional way is to use two magnetic tunable filters separately (2-6GHz and 6-18GHz), and assembly two independent digital drivers. Making the system as compact as possible is a trend for all electronics industry. Integrating one digital driver and with the size of one single band pass filter to cover the full frequency range of 2-18GHz plays an important role to lower the size and weight, as well as the power consumption.The main purpose of this article is to realize covering full band of 2-18GHz frequency range by one single broadband filter, and meet all technical specifications. The 2-18GHz digital controlled broadband tunable band pass filter module is combined by a magnetic tunable bandpass filter and its digital driver which controlled the filter by 14 Bit TTL.The filter part is integrated by 2 filters and 2 switches. Among them, the 2-6GHz broadband tunable filter is the most difficult to produce, it used unconventional strong coupling technology of poly crystal spheres. The 6-18GHz broadband tunable filter adopts high magnetic moments spheres with whole loop coupling, and reducing the distance between resonating spheres, etc. The two filters are all designed under the same magnetic pole, the air gap of the magnetic pole is designed in ladder shape, the switch is also integrated inside of the filter to realize the miniaturization of the 2-18GHz broadband tunable filter. The digital driver mainly includes the switch driver and filter driver, the switch driver controls the switching between two broadband bandpass filters; the filter driver controls instantaneous passband frequency of the filters.Based on the above, this paper described the design of 2-18GHz broadband digitally tuned bandpass filters, their digital drivers, and how the modules work.
